UCF Pulls Off Exciting Comeback, Edges Arizona State 79-76

UCF Triumphs Over Arizona State in Thrilling Matchup

In a thrilling matchup on Tuesday night, the University of Central Florida (UCF) overcame a late deficit to snatch a 79-76 victory against Arizona State. Riley Kugel led the Knights with 17 points, while his teammate Jordan Burks not only contributed 15 points but also delivered a crucial 3-pointer in the dying moments of the game.

Key Moments of the Game

UCF showcased their perseverance by executing a decisive 14-2 run, which brought the score to a tied 72-72 with just over two minutes left on the clock. Burks’ timely three-pointer put UCF ahead 78-76 with 34 seconds remaining, and he played a pivotal role in forcing a turnover on the ensuing Arizona State possession.

Themus Fulks added 12 points for UCF and helped secure the win by converting one of his two free throw attempts shortly before the final buzzer. Arizona State’s Bryce Ford had the chance to tie the game with a three-pointer on the last play but missed the shot, sealing UCF’s victory. Aside from Kugel’s performance, Jamichael Stillwell contributed significantly with 14 points, and John Bol dominated the boards with 10 rebounds, while Kugel and Stillwell each recorded nine rebounds.

Arizona State’s Performance

On the other side, Arizona State’s Maurice Odum was a standout, scoring 18 points and hitting three three-pointers, while Anthony Johnson and Bryce Ford chipped in with 12 and 11 points respectively. The Sun Devils had initially taken control of the game, leveraging a strong 23-11 run to build their largest lead of 70-58 with just over six minutes to go. They led 39-35 at halftime after a late first half surge, which started with Odum hitting a three-pointer about six minutes before the break. This exciting matchup marked Arizona State’s first appearance in Orlando for this series.

Looking Ahead

Looking ahead, Arizona State will host the No. 1 ranked Arizona on Saturday, while UCF will face off against No. 11 Texas Tech at home the same day.
